Understanding the Phishing Scheme

The specific type of scam occurring with calls from 03 7067 5197 / 0370675197 falls under the category of tech support scams. In these scenarios, fraudsters impersonate legitimate companies such as Microsoft, leading victims to believe that their computer has been compromised or that there are issues with their software. The goal of these callers is to extract personal information such as passwords or enable remote access to your device, putting your privacy and data at risk.

How to Handle Calls from 03 7067 5197

To protect yourself from such scams:

  • Do not engage with the caller. Hang up immediately if you receive a call from this number.
  • Do not provide any personal details or follow any instructions from the caller.
  • Consider blocking the number and alerting relevant authorities about the scam.
